Propeller Test: 

A test was conducted on two marine propellers to provide a barrier to corrosion and a smooth non stick surface to inhibit the growth of marine life. The propellers were coated in HO1 then top coated with SO2 and fitted to a customers boat permanently moored in a marina in the ocean.

Boat Prop covered in salt and sea life

Boat Prop sprayed with water to loosen salt and sea life Boat Prop clean after whipping with a cloth with no damage.

After 12 months full time
salt water immersion.

After a water blast to
remove loose debris.

After wiping with a wet cloth the
coating shows no deterioration.

The propellers were blasted cleaned of any previous contamination by thermal degrease and grit blasting. They were then coated with H01 and cured then re blasted to etch the surface and top coated with SO2 non stick solid dry film then cured again. The propellers were then fitted to the boat and left moored in a marina in the ocean for a period of 12 months when the boat was removed for annual inspection and maintenance.

RESULTS

There were no signs of corrosion or pin holes in the coating observed, a small amount of marine growth was seen, less than usual and was able to be easily removed with a water blast and wipe with a wet rag. The boat was returned to the sea without further work to the propellers for a second year.

COMMENTS 

After 12 months full time immersion and some use by the owner the boat was removed from the water to carry out
maintenance and inspect the propellers.  The owner commented that with uncoated propellers there is a drop off in fuel economy due to the marine growth causing parasitic drag, with coated propellers there was no reduction in fuel economy.

SKIN TEMPERTURE REDUCTIONS USING HPC E SERIES COATINGS

Testing was conducted by Marsh Motorsports of New Zealand on a Mercruiser 900 (496 CID) engine to determine the temperature reduction that could be expected on the exhaust headers from the use of E-Series coatings. The coating reduced external skin temperature by 56% (600°F).

The engine was configured as follows:
Engine type: Mercruiser 900

E13 coating was applied to one of the eight header pipes (cylinder 2 on chart below) while the other pipes remained uncoated. The engine was tested on a STUSKA Engine Co. dynamometer between 6000 and 7500 RPM. The external surface temperatures of the header pipes were measured with thermocouples located one inch from the header/head-mounting flange.

Results

Mean temp. of cylinder 2 pipe: 475° F
Mean temp. of other pipes: 1078° F
